Augmented Reality represents a paradigm shift in technology, where virtual elements blend seamlessly with the real world. Unlike Virtual Reality (VR), which creates entirely immersive digital environments, AR enhances our physical reality by augmenting it with digital content. AR enables us to interact with virtual objects and information within our natural environment by harnessing the power of computer vision, machine learning, and advanced sensors.
AR experiences can be broadly categorized into three types. The first type involves object detection, where digital objects or worlds are spawned based on the detection of real-world objects or images. This is evident in popular applications like Snapchat and Instagram filters, where facial recognition technology brings a myriad of playful and creative effects to our selfies.
The second type is world-scale AR, which leverages the detection of physical locations to overlay pre-built virtual worlds. One notable example is the groundbreaking game, Pokemon GO, where players explore their surroundings to find virtual creatures and engage in real-world location-based gameplay. World-scale AR has the potential to revolutionize not just gaming but also indoor navigation, interactive events, and more.
As exciting as AR may be, it comes with its fair share of challenges. One significant hurdle is achieving precise alignment between the digital and physical worlds. Inaccurate object placement or marker alignment can break the immersive experience and hinder the usefulness of AR applications. Additionally, accurately localizing users within the digital world poses another obstacle, as it requires robust positioning technologies and real-time scanning of the environment.
The future of AR lies in a combination of innovative approaches and powerful tools. Developers can rebuild physical spaces digitally to create seamless AR experiences. Advanced technologies like LiDAR and depth-of-field sensors aid in real-time scanning and precise localization, enabling virtual objects to interact convincingly with the physical environment. Game engines like Unity, combined with specialized AR development tools, empower creators to build immersive and interactive AR applications.
AR has already made its mark in various industries. Pokemon GO, a prime example, revolutionized the gaming landscape by introducing shared AR experiences and fostering community engagement. Superworld, an AR-based real estate app, allows users to create and explore virtual experiences within specific geographical locations. These examples demonstrate the immense potential of AR beyond entertainment, extending into education, retail, healthcare, and more.
